Usina del Arte

Located in the vibrant neighborhood of La Boca in Buenos Aires, Usina del Arte stands as a cultural hub within the city. Housed in a restored power plant, this venue offers a diverse array of artistic events and exhibitions, ranging from music concerts to visual arts showcases. Its industrial architecture juxtaposed with contemporary artistic expression creates a unique ambiance, drawing both locals and tourists alike to immerse themselves in Buenos Aires' rich cultural scene at Usina del Arte.

In the heart of the Barracas neighborhood in Buenos Aires, the Silos Areneros proudly display a monumental mural by Alfredo Segatori. Stretching across the towering silos, Segatori's artwork depicts vibrant scenes of Argentine culture and history, capturing the essence of the community. This striking mural not only transforms the industrial landscape but also serves as a testament to the power of art in revitalizing urban spaces, inviting visitors to admire its grandeur and immerse themselves in the stories it portrays.
